QUESTION FOUR (15 Marks) Star (Pty) Ltd purchased new equipment to replace equipment that it has used for five years. The company paid a net purchase price of R200 000, brokerage fees of R5 000, legal fees of R2 000, and freight and insurance in transit of R3 000. In addition, the company paid R1 500 to remove old equipment and R2 000 to install new equipment. Calculate the cost of new equipment for Star (Pty) Ltd and process the journal entry to record the purchase of the equipment paying R70,000 in cash.
